Opening Period Gameplay

Scoreless at 13:30 in the first

Here we go! And we have an exciting start after the Colts running back receives a short throw, sweeps out for 15 yards to the right side then loses the ball … only for his offensive lineman to recover the fumble with the recovery. Colts are in Falcons territory already.

Colts 0-0 Falcons 10:51, 1st quarter

And the excitement continues as the Indianapolis attempts a fourth-down conversion. The risk doesn't work out as the wide receiver cannot reel in a quick pass from Jones. On the play before the turnover on downs the Falcons defender put a massive tackle on the Colts' tight end. The Falcons have come out fighting on defense as they attempt to end their string of three losses. Next up Sauce Garner’s debut!

Score Updates

First score: Colts lead 6-0 at 8:36

Did Kyle Pitts just drop a touchdown? The Falcons player makes a crucial error, he was very open but the ball just swishes through his hands. That moment reflects the first round pick’s career to date.

A disappointing start but it only deteriorates for the Atlanta as they turn over possession to the Indianapolis on the 23-yard mark. Michael Penix Jr is hunted down and fumbles the football.

An agile 22-yard rush from the Colts receiver sets the running back up to roll in for the score on the following play. Kicker Michael Badgley misses the point after attempt. Oops.

TOUCHDOWN! Colts 6-7 Falcons 6:07, 1st quarter

Penix Jr puts the fumble behind him by marching his Falcons down the field for a touchdown. Drake London makes some substantial catches to put them in the scoring area then the seas part for Tyler Allgeier to saunter on to the goal line through the middle of the defense for 13 yards. He completes the drive for a short scoring run of his own. The Falcons take the lead.
